NAEA ROCK SPRINGS LLC is a 773 MW natural gas power plant in Cecil County, MD, operated by NAEA ROCK SPRINGS LLC, commissioned in 2003. Cecil County carries low modeled catastrophe exposure in the FEMA National Risk Index, scoring 1.3 of 5 at the 9th national percentile. Hurricane is the leading peril, rated Relatively Low by FEMA at the 70th percentile.

The Bywatts loss layer is calibrated to solar PV hardware, so it is not applied to a natural gas plant. The ratings below are the FEMA National Risk Index county hazard ratings for this location.
